    Accommodation in bouganvilla aparthotel is small but adequate for needs and my biggest moan was no aircon or even a fan. You had to hire a fan at 15 euro for week and 15 euro deposit which personally annoyed me you are on holiday in hot country and they cant even provide a fan in accom without additional charge. I opted to buy one from a hypermarket and although I will be going back to the same part of Majorca again next year I will be looking at hotels nearer to beach and that provide a fan or aircon as standard.

    We had booked for self catering but did pay to eat at the buffet restaurant a few times which cost 36 euro for a family of four for an evening meal which had plenty of choice. The main pool was very big and was kept clean however sun loungers are a nightmare I only used the pool on a morning for a swim before we went out for day and even at 9am all sun loungers had towels on them but 90% had no body lying on them quite a few people complain about this however nothing much gets done although bouganvilla policy is that people cannot reserve sunloungers and towels can be removed by staff if needed.

    Towels in accom where changed nearly every day. The entertainment was okay but too be honest it will never be a butlins and we opted to travel out of the resort most days and evenings traveling the island various destinations.

    The resort itself is a bit of a walk from the main area of sa coma and the beach, we had a hire car for the week so didn't really affect us and Bouganvilla do have a train that travels to the beach every day so the distance isn't really a concern. Also a bit of a walk away is the sa coma hypermarket which I would recommend you visiting if self catering and if you want to buy a fan as they sell them for around 16 euros.

    Sa Coma is a very nice area of Majorca, clean beach, plenty of places to eat and not to far from Cala Millor.

    Personally its not a bad hotel and if they sorted out an inclusive fan or 2 per accom and maybe a TV (yes you have to hire those as well), sorted out the sunlounger hoggers, maybe just go round and throw peoples towels into the pool until they get the message if you aint lying on them then let some one else use them. I would consider using them again.
